Sphalerite with Fluorite
specimen number:
1653408
location:
Wheal Trelawney, Menheniot, Cornwall, England, UK
description:
Crystals of sphalerite across the top of a colorless fluorite crystal matrix. In good condition with minimal damage along the edges of the piece. The specimen comes with several previous labels including a hand written one initial by Richard Barstow in 1972. These are shown at the end of the video.
